Flores) Governor Napolitano has asked the universities and community colleges to work together to double the number of bachelor’s degrees by 2020. To do this, a number of challenges must be addresses, including appropriate funding models that better support strategic goals, governance structurethat enables coordination system wide, determining and sustaining student demand, establishing university presence and advising throughout the state, and establishing criteria to make market based decisions regarding degree programs, among others. Possible programs for PCC: Health Care Administration (builds on PCC Associate in Allied Health) BAS – Occupational Trades Management Physicians Assistant For each of these programs, PCC has to: - look at other community colleges to see what has worked for them as well as examine their funding 8 process

Fiscal Year Budget (D. Bea) Dr. Bea distributed copies of a travel summary for FY 09. The budget for FY 09 will be based on FY 07 Actual Expenditures or whatever is less based on the FY 09 budget request. For Contractual Services and Supplies, the budget will be based on FY 07 + 5%. The Chancellor gave some guidelines for travel including appropriate conferences for positions (e.g. AACC is for Executive Administrators and possibly Deans of Instructions or AVCs.) 2c.
